Before the New York Rangers begin their 2015-16 regular season campaign on Oct. 7 at Chicago, the team will hold an open practice at West Point on Monday Oct. 5 beginning at 11AM.  According to the Army Sports Website the practice is open to the public at Tate Rink.  Afterwards the team will dine at The Cadet Mess Hall with students.

This is the first visit for the Rangers since 2007 and their third overall since coming in 2005.

Other teams that have visited West Point are the Florida Panthers, Pittsburgh Penguins, Philadelphia Flyers, Buffalo Sabres, and the New Jersey Devils.
